CULTURE TUESDAY - Bishop Timothy Menezes & Claire Reay - The Empty Chair

Bishop Timothy Menezes, Auxiliary of Birmingham and Claire Reay, Head of Safeguarding, join Fr Toby on the National Day of Prayer for Survivors of Abuse to discuss safeguarding and to pray for survivors of abuse. In particular, they look at this year's theme, 'The Empty Chair', and the sadness of so many missing from the pews due to the experience of abuse to them or loved ones.

PATRISTIC PILLARS - Fr Joseph Hamilton - Pope Leo the Great, Part 2

Still bristling with gladness the day after attending the new Holy Father's inauguration Mass, Fr Joseph delivers Part 2 of his look the Pope's namesake, Leo the Great. Fr Joseph Hamilton is the Rector of the Domus Australia in Rome, and a priest of the Archdiocese of Sydney Australia. Prior to his appointment at Domus, he served as private secretary to George Cardinal Pell, until the Cardinal’s untimely death. Fr Joseph completed his doctoral studies in Patristics at Christ Church, University of Oxford, and his license at the Patristic Institute “Augustinianum” in Rome. Prior to entering seminary he worked as an investment banker. Having left the economy of Mammon for that of Salvation, he studied at the Pontifical North American College. A native of Ireland, he is a keen but mediocre (his words) surfer, and enjoys reading and cooking.
